I suppose I wanted to restart the 'groundlings with Spelljamming' thread
again, but I wanted a discussion about it with some new perspectives.

Obviously, if a ship isn't going to be more than a day from replentishing
its air, perhaps only leaving the atmosphere to get to the other side
of the planet it can have a _much_ larger crew.  A ship that expects
a 2-3 month journey between replentishing the air will have a much
greater ship mass/crew ratio.

Now I'll call a ship which has a ship mass/crew ratio sufficient to have
good air on 2-3 month voyages a WildSpace ship, and one whose crew/lift
weight of helm ratio is maximized a groundling ship.

If you give the Wild Space shipwright only a slight edge in materials
and magic, but give the Wild Space crews all the proficiencies
necessary to operate a ship well, what would happen when you put
equal tonnage of Wild Space fleet vs groundling fleet?

It wouldn't be a match. The speed and manuverabilty of the spelljamming
fleet would allow them to make high speed passes at the other fleet.
They could literally come out of nowhere to strike. Only if the
groundling fleet had air support would they have a chance. In fact, a
smart commander would sacrifice ships and crew to bring down at least
one of the enemy SJ ships so they could get the technology.

You must also remember that the defending fleet has unlimited resources.
They can manufacture more ships, more quickly, than a fleet that has to
travel 2-3 months. They also, if they organize, have access to thousands
of mages worldwide that they could use in the assault. What would happen
to the SJ fleet if 16 fireballs and 24 lightning bolts came from each of
the ships in the groundling fleet? Admittedly this wouldn't happen
during the first battle, but what ruler is going to let that kind of
attack suceed more than once?

I would imagine that any ruler worth his upumm....salt...would hire a
mage to research the strange ships, perhaps even offering a reward for
knowledge of these strange vessels. Remember again, it says in the rules
that groundling mages know of the existence of Spelljamming cultures and
technology, it's just not  important to them.

I think I'll stop now, this could go on and on...
